Output 71dcdc89a03be3edfc9bbd23f3dcfe33f156d818a394458184188341498a0aa6:5

value
36685
script pubkey
OP_0 OP_PUSHBYTES_20 2d15d2674420756d6c8874d1c49975e758ee3e94
address
bc1q952aye6yyp6k6mygwngufxt4uavwu0553t7ze5
transaction
71dcdc89a03be3edfc9bbd23f3dcfe33f156d818a394458184188341498a0aa6
spent
true